Me & my Dad were one of those 5 or 6, we ran an 18 ft unlimited ( Ralph "Bunky" Muirhead) with a wood deck. My Pop drove the boat while I hung on for dear life 200 feet behind on a racing ski. The only rig we never beat was a Sanger hydro, "The White Mist" I think was the name.

Billy, As you know, I was there on that beach. A humming sound at first, kinda hard to identify, then a droning, like a squad of fighter planes off in the distance, then as it got louder, looking down river, little white splashes all the way across the river, still to far away to actually see what it was, then the unmistakable whine of blowers, then independant exhaust sounds, then it became clear.........Those little splashes were boats, several v drives screaming and whining, then BOOM, you were on us, again like a squadren of fighters, then one by one, doing those "fly bys"...........Pure sound, the best music in the world, in perfect harmony, zoom, zoom, zoom.....Up the river, a dozen or so truely hot boats cracking the morning air. Those that wern't awake when it started were awake now! People stumbling out of trailers, tents, motorhomes, to come to the beach with mouths wide open, chins dragging the ground, as you guys ran up and down the river. I can hear it right now, the sights that morning are kinda blurry, but that sound will never be forgotten. Whata show!! whata surprise!!..........Thanks again........Ray
